California Tenants – A Guide to Residential Tenants' and Landlords' Rights and Responsibilities was written initially by the Department of Consumer Affairs' Legal Affairs Division and substantially revised by the Department of Real Estate's Legal Affairs Division in 2020. The easiest way you can reduce your Solar Panel's Voltage is by using either an MPPT Charge Controller or a Step-Down Converter (aka Buck Converter). Other solutions are to use resistors or modify the solar cells' connections via the junction box. . When it comes to setting up a 12V solar system, one of the most common-and important questions people ask is "What size cable should for my solar panel?" If you use smaller wires, the voltage will decrease, the heat will accumulate, and there will be power loss.

Smart grids are advanced electricity distribution systems that leverage digital technology to enhance the efficiency, reliability, and sustainability of energy delivery.
